According to the cartoon, the fire of anarchy is spreading over Cuba.

The two groups creating/fanning the flames are the Cubans loyal to the Spanish rule and the Cuban independentists.

The duty of the hour for the United States is not only liberate Cuba from the Spanish rule but from a worse fate than that one.

This cartoon is most likely from the Spanish/United States war of 1898. During this war, the American army faced the Spanish army to help the Cubans obtain their independence. The cartoonist wanted the viewer to support the war as a fight for liberty, because the United States interference in this foreign affair was controversial.

- His intentions weren't to discover the Americas (which were already discovered by Leif Ericcson and others), or to prove the Earth was round (Which has already been proven long ago, and despite popular belief, even the Bible says the Earth is round.)

- He thought that the Carribean was the Spice Islands. He eventually realized that this was the Americas, but even on his third visit, he still thought he was somewhere close to India or China.

- He only landed in the West Indies and in South America. He never sat foot on the continent of North America, and he has absolutely NOTHING TO DO WITH THE UNITED STATES!-from debate.org
